What are the different constituents of petroleum? What are the uses of petroleum products?

Open in App
Solution

The different constituents of petroleum -LPG, Petrol, Kerosene, Diesel, Lubricating oil, Paraffin wax, Bitumen

The different uses of petroleum products are:
(a) LPG is used as a fuel for home and industry.
(b) Petrol is used as motor fuel, aviation fuel, and solvent for dry cleaning.
(c) Kerosene is used as fuel for stoves, lamps, and jet aircraft.
(d) Diesel is used as fuel for heavy motor vehicles, electric generators, etc.
(e) Lubricating oil is used in machines to lubricate the different parts.
(f) Paraffin wax is used as an ointment, candle, and vaseline.
(g)Bitumen is used in road surfacing and painting.
